
How to Evaluate Your Own Site's SEO Profile

Before you can evaluate your site’s SEO profile, you need to
understand what an SEO profile is and how it works. An SEO
profile for a website is just like a marketing plan or a
business plan – basically, it’s a strategy document, putting
your decisions into words. This is best performed on a computer
program such as Microsoft Word as these programs do provide the

Writing your SEO profile should consist of the following:
An
introduction - This should include a BRIEF description of your
company as well as a purpose statement of some kind. If you can
describe your company in a neat, tight format, you will be one step
ahead of most in the SEO game.
Goals relating to your Search Engine Status - What do you want your
page rank to be? Where do you want to be listed under specif key
words? top 50? 25? 10? How many pages of your site do you want
search engines to index? Do you want to pay for listings? These
questions will get you started, but you must go more in-depth into
your SEO goals. Also include the search engines and directories that
you feel are necessities such as Google, DMOZ, Yahoo!, and MSN. |
Information regarding SEO actions and achievements - This one is
pretty self-explanatory. List everything that you do regarding
Search Engine Optimization as well as any successes caused by
these actions.
Once you’ve written an SEO profile, you can compare it from
time-to-time with what’s going on with your site, before either
adjusting the site to reflect your strategy or adjusting the
profile to reflect a strategy change. Generally, it is wise to
stick to the plan, but occasions may arise when you find that
this is simply not logical anymore. In these cases, you must
re-evaluate your entire plan because one change can effect the
rest of your strategy. If you have an extremely intricate
strategy that depends on one thing going well, you may want to
diversify your strategy. Your profile should especially focus on
special things you plan to do that aren’t standard SEO practice.
Standard SEO work can get you only so far. Every one of your
competitors is probably doing the same things so get creative.
This is one place where doing something for yourself can really
push you to the top. If you already have a high-ranking site,
you should use your profile to document the reasons why it has
happened, to help you maintain your high ranking.
Keeping your SEO profile updated will allow you to stay current
not only on what’s going on with your website, but also on
what’s going on in the SEO industry. The SEO industry is very
fickle. It can change suddenly without warning to reflect what a
search engine or directory believes to be the opinion or benefit
of the market. Remember that search engines are always in
competition with one another to deliver the most results of the
highest quality. If you stay on top of your quality, changes in
the SEO industry will have minimal effect on you. It is still
important to track these changes in order to ensure that your
site gets maximum exposure. Evaluating your website and profile
regularly give you an advantage in the market – you should never
let a profile get older than 3 months, and you should refer to
it and update it every time you make major changes to your site.
These changes include additions of services or removal of
services as well as design changes and SEO work.
